What Actually Is Vanity Replacement?
Vanity replacement refers to fully extracting your old bathroom vanity — including the base cabinet, countertop surface, bowl, and drain connections — and mounting an entirely fresh assembly in its place. This differs from a simple resurfacing task, where purely the surface is changed.
What's involved of a vanity replacement differs significantly depending on the existing plumbing configuration. Certain installations are relatively straightforward — trading a common-dimension vanity for a comparable unit. More complex cases involve adjusting drain positions, modifying wall surfaces, or reinforcing the structural base beneath the cabinet.

The Vanity Replacement Procedure Step by Step
-
In-Home Assessment and Planning
A Brother & Brother Builders specialist comes to your property to evaluate the current vanity setup. We take precise measurements of the footprint, identify shutoff valve positions, and go over your style choices for the new unit.
-
Choosing Your Vanity and Materials
Based on your budget and goals, we help you select the right vanity cabinet — along with sink and hardware options. Popular choices include granite, ceramic, and cultured marble. Materials are ordered and verified before the job begins.
-
Shutoff and Demolition
The shutoff valves are closed before the old unit is touched. Old hardware comes out first, followed by the countertop. The vanity box is taken out to protect the adjacent walls.
-
Subwall Inspection and Plumbing Adjustment
After removal, our crew inspects the wall cavity for signs of water intrusion. Remediation work are handled at this phase before new materials are installed. Plumbing is adjusted if necessary to align with the replacement unit.
-
Mounting the Replacement Unit
The incoming unit is set in place correctly aligned against the wall. It's anchored to studs to prevent movement for years of daily use. Adjustable legs and shims are used wherever the subfloor isn't perfectly flat.
-
Countertop, Sink, and Faucet Hookup
The sink deck is placed and sealed along the back edge to keep water out. Your chosen sink style is fitted and locked in place. Fresh hardware are plumbed in and checked for leaks.
-
Final Inspection and Cleanup
Each fitting gets checked for correct installation. Our team runs water at every point and checks that drainage flows without issue. The job site is left clean before we consider the job done.

Vanity Replacement FAQ
How long does a vanity replacement usually last from start to finish?
Most vanity replacement projects wraps up in a single day or two depending on how much prep work is needed. Installations requiring significant plumbing relocation sometimes take a bit longer to finish correctly.
What does vanity replacement typically run in San Jose?
The cost of vanity replacement varies based on a few variables: vanity size, material quality, and labor complexity. San Jose residents spend in the range of $1,000 to $4,000 for a fully finished vanity replacement. Luxury or oversized vanities can cost more those estimates.
Is vanity replacement hard on the household?
Considerably less inconvenient than most clients anticipate. Your sink area is unusable for a portion of the day during the installation phase. We lays down protective coverings to shield your surrounding finishes from construction residue.
How long do vanity replacement results stay looking good?
Quality cabinetry and countertops can easily last well beyond a decade with regular cleaning and basic maintenance. Plumbing components may need attention sooner, while the primary structure can remain in excellent shape long-term.
